- Hostinger: Not totally free. So, out of question right now.
- Weebly: Just like Wix. I have to build with what they will give me and doesn't support PHP. So.....
- Wix: Same as above.
- 20i: "All free users only get 250MB each month, an amount that will disappear faster than you can say ‘boo’." So, basically useless.
- 000Webhost: "000Webhost platform users will have to put up with an enforced one hour of “sleep” time every day. This means that it will be unavailable to anyone – including yourself." One hour of "SLEEP TIME" ?! Seriously ?!
- 5GB Free: "March 2021 Update: 5GBFree no longer seems to be active. While there has been no official announcement, public comments indicate that users can no longer access the site." So, it's of no use.
- Awardspace: 30MB MySQL size quota. No one specifies that. Except phpBB, I think no CMS based website can cope with this limitation.
- ByetHost: 5-10 visits in a day to your site and it will go down for at least 72 hours.
- Dreamnix: Only 60 days FREE trial period. I need at least a 6 months period.
- Freehostia: Biiiigggg 250MB space... khik khik.. khuk khuk... khak khak
- FreeHosting.com: "there is a caveat in their terms of service; There is an ‘out’ clause there that basically states that they can shut you down if you’re taking up too much (unspecified) resources." It is just worst than ByetHost. Even a Joomla installation can cause that "taking up too much resources".. believe me. I have experience.
- There is really nothing to discuss about FreehostingEU, FreeHostingNoAds, FreeVirtualServers and FreeWebHostingArea because they all are basically useless.
- InstaFree: This one is really good and legit but India is in their 'Ban-list'.
